Finding film – old school, actual photo film – at the dump, triggered this whole documenting things at the dump project. Both film and older digital cameras have the ability to communicate a time or nostalgia through the way the light is captured.

One of my first good point and shoot camera finds was a Canon Powershot ELPH180.

Truthfully, The daylight shots aren’t too bad. Any shots taken past dusk or in a dark room are horrible- unless blurry, streaky, pixelated shots are your aesthetic.

The Canon PowerShot ELPH 180 is one hefty point and shoot at 20 Mega Pixels. Saving your memories to your phone and sharing immediately cheapens the moment. Sharing a shot with your IRL friends at the time of the shot – priceless. Look at this tiny 5cm x 5cm screen. No zits or no wrinkles when you look at pics on your point and shoot.
